VBH Deutschland GmbH has announced plans for a phased shutdown of its operations by the end of 2025. The company made the announcement on 6 August, informing employees of the inability to find an investor or another continuation strategy. Earlier, on 1 July 2025, the court in Ludwigsburg opened insolvency proceedings under self-administration.
Until the end of October, customers will be able to place orders, which the company intends to fulfil as usual. After that, VBH Deutschland GmbH will complete product shipments and begin an orderly wind-down of operations. Managing director Fekke van Dijk stressed that the transition period should allow customers time to switch to other players in the window market.
The company’s second managing director, Bernd Grupp, thanked employees for their dedicated work, especially in recent months, and noted that the liquidation process will be coordinated with suppliers and contractors. For employees whose jobs will be lost by year-end, a compensation package is currently being agreed, with negotiations in the final stage.
VBH Deutschland GmbH supplies window and door manufacturers with a full range of products and system solutions for production and installation, including the greenteQ brand, as well as products for security systems. The company is part of the VBH Group, which operates in more than 20 countries and is actively expanding its business outside Germany. The closure applies only to the German division.
